First, the background of this car is that it was a father/son project for about 10 years. Almost everything is brand new. Rotisserie Restoration, and assembled on a lift. I have countless pictures of the build process and 3 binders full of receipts and manuals for parts on the car. The honest reason for selling the car is that I want to start another project with my Dad. It is a good reason to spend more time together. This car started life as a 1973 but has been "cloned" to a 1970 front end.
This car was professionally appraised in 2019 for 85K. We have a clean title. Located in Columbus Ohio.

Drivetrain:
The engine started life as a 5.7L Hemi in a 2014 dodge ram with only 30,000 miles. It was then rebuilt by Fowler Performance Engines here in Columbus Ohio. It has a stroker kit from Manley that brings the engine to 6.4L and 392 cu.in. 4.050 in. stroke, 4340 Crank, 6.125in I beam connecting rods, and Manley pistons. Comp Cam XTREME Fuel Injection Hydraulic roller cam with VVT phaser and cylinder deactivation solenoids removed. 6.1L aluminum intake manifold. New front accessory cover to replace the truck style cover. 11.1:1 compression, runs on 93 pump gas. A custom dual snorkel cold air intake is installed. Fowler Engines guessed it will do over 500HP to the wheels but it has not been dynoed. The fuel injection is run by a Holley Dominator and their plug n play harnesses. Brand new multicore aluminum radiator with dual electric fans and shroud. New MSD blaster coil packs.
Optima Redtop Battery trunk mounted.
Brand new driveshaft and rear end center with posi-traction and 3.55 gearing. New Yukon axles.

Transmission:
5-speed tremec from SilverSport with a QuickTime bellhousing and hydraulic throw out bearing kit.

Flowmaster Exhaust and ceramic coated headers. There are electronic dumping valves on the exhaust hooked up to a switch on the center console. You can make the car sound refined and smooth for the highway or cruising, or flip a switch and the car cracks concrete.

Wheels:
TSW Geneva's in Gunmetal Grey. These cover Wilwood 4-piston brakes on all 4 corners. Drilled and slotted rotors. Parking brake kit from Wilwood also as well as their master cylinder. Tires are Nitto NT555 G2's.

Suspension:
Hotchkis TVS kit. Includes new upper a-arms with improved geometry, front and rear sway bars, and frame ties. The car handles awesome.

Misc. Exterior:
The exterior of the car is finished in Plum Crazy purple based on the 2015 Hellcat color. A few modern challenger parts were grafted in to update the look like side markers, taillights, and a fuel filler cap. Both bumpers were kissed in to clean it up further. The front fenders, door skins, full quarter panels, both rockers, front and rear valances, trunk lid, and hood are all BRAND NEW. Sheet metal was from Auto Metal Direct. A remote door opening kit was installed so the exterior door handles could be shaved to give the car an even cleaner look. Ring Brothers billet aluminum hood hinges, clutch reservoir, and hood pins.

The interior of the car has brand new Braum racing seats with their 5-point harnesses. Grant steering wheel. Auto Meter Ultra-Lite II gauges. Custom center console. Brand new rear seat covers, carpet, and headliner. All glass is brand new. It has a JBL sound system with 2 5-1/2 speakers up front and 6 x 9's in the rear.

Has the factory 2014 hemi A/C compressor and alternator.

There are a few things about the car that are not perfect. The interior is not perfect, also the fuel injection is not tuned by a professional yet. The A/C system has a small leak somewhere so it currently does not work. Everything in the A/C system is brand new though. The car is a driver. It has been to Mopar Nationals at National Trail Raceway and been to several other car shows. I have driven it 40 minutes to work several times. It runs and looks great, but this is not a trailer queen SEMA build.

I will throw in all the original OEM parts left over from the build including the 73 front grille assembly (headlights and grille assemblies) as well as the 73 taillights. I have entire tubs of more small stuff that you can have. I also still have the original Rallye style wheels.
